I plant my seeds directly in the soil. I make a little pocket ( about 1 inch in diameter) and fill that with vermiculite. This holds a lot of moisture around the seeds and when the root breaks free it doesnt have far to go untill it finds the good stuff.

I know a lot of growers use the paper towl method but since I hardly ever have a problem getting my seeds to germinate I stick with what works for me. I just don't like the idea of handling the seeds after they have germinated.

I keep my seeds at 75F for germination
